What is Green Roofing?
Green roofing, also known as sustainable or eco-friendly roofing, refers to roofing systems that incorporate living elements like vegetation or plants. These roofs are designed to provide a range of environmental benefits while contributing to the energy efficiency of your building. From reducing energy costs to improving air quality, green roofing systems are becoming an increasingly popular choice for commercial and residential buildings alike.

1. Environmental Benefits of Green Roofs
One of the primary benefits of green roofs is their positive impact on the environment. Here are some key environmental advantages:
- How Green Roofs Handle Stormwater: Green roofs absorb and retain rainwater, reducing runoff and helping to manage stormwater in urban areas. This prevents water from overwhelming drainage systems, minimizing flooding risks.
- Green Roofs as Natural Air Filters: Plants on green roofs filter pollutants from the air, contributing to cleaner, healthier air in your community.
- Combatting Heat Islands: Green roofing systems combat the urban heat island effect, creating cooler and more comfortable environments.
2. Economic Benefits: Savings & Incentives
Sustainable roofing systems like green roofs can help you save money and earn incentives. Consider these benefits:
- Lower Energy Bills: By insulating your building, green roofs reduce heating and cooling expenses, creating energy-efficient spaces.
- Extended Roof Lifespan: Protecting your roof with a green system ensures long-term durability and minimizes repair costs.
- Government Support for Green Roofs: Many regions offer financial incentives, rebates, or tax breaks for installing green roofs due to their environmental benefits. These can help offset the initial installation costs.

Different Green Roof Styles
Green roofs come in various forms to suit diverse building needs. Here’s a breakdown:
- Simplified Green Roofing: A cost-effective, lightweight option, extensive green roofs focus on drought-tolerant vegetation.
- High-Maintenance, High-Reward Roofs: For those seeking versatile greenery, intensive green roofs are a perfect solution, offering more depth and variety.
- Convenient Green Roof Solutions: Designed for flexibility, modular green roofs allow for easy customization and placement.
5. Green Roofing Installation Process
Green roofing installation demands careful planning and expert execution. Key steps include:
- Weight Support Analysis: The roof must be strong enough to support the additional weight of the green roof system, including soil, plants, and water. A professional inspection ensures your building is suitable for this upgrade.
- Installation of Waterproofing and Drainage Layers: Proper drainage prevents water pooling and extends the life of your green roof system.
- The Final Green Touch: A growing medium (soil) is added, and plants are carefully selected and placed based on the roof’s design and climate conditions.
